Abstract
Based on the Aesthetics of Reception theory, this paper discusses how the humanities literacy foundation courses represented by 'Modern and Contemporary Chinese Literature' can break the knowledge boundaries of 'the past and the present,' 'online and offline,' 'Chinese and new media,' 'arts and sciences' with the advent of AI technology, and foster a four-dimensional integration of teaching across time and disciplines, highlighting the student-centered teaching concept, innovating the personalized aesthetic integrated circle of humanities literacy courses with 'perception, appreciation, creation,' and fully addressing and aligning with the demands for talent cultivation in the new era of new liberal arts.
